The two-family house at 236 Ashford Street in East New York, owned by Muxiu Li, is a two-story building constructed in 1901 and currently contains two residential units.
The most notable aspect of the building's recent history is its bedbug reporting record, though fortunately, the reports from both 2023 and 2024 indicate no infestation issues, with the official records showing zero infested units, zero units requiring eradication, and zero re-infestation cases.
This consistent pattern of non-infestation over the past two years suggests effective management of potential pest issues, though it should be noted that the building is required to submit annual bedbug reports regardless of any problems. The absence of any other significant building violations or complaints on record during this period suggests relatively stable maintenance conditions, though the age of the structure may warrant regular attention to various building systems.
